N. Macedonia increases electricity prices for most households

June 28 (SeeNews) - North Macedonia's Energy and Water Services Regulatory Commission (ERC) said it will increase prices for electricity used by the majority of households starting July 1, following a request from the country's universal electricity supplier, EVN Home.

Electricity prices will increase by about 0.4% for approximately 88% of households in tier 1 and tier 2, ERC said in a press release on Thursday.

For consumers in tier 3, which comprise about 8% of households, the price will increase by 0.48%, and for tier 4, the price will increase by 0.57%, Marko Bislimoski, president of ERC, said in the statement.
